Motor shows have been held in Germany for over 100 years. They were not called the IAA from the very beginning, but by 1951 at the latest, when the trade fair moved from Berlin to Frankfurt, the IAA was becoming increasingly international and was mentioned in the same breath as Paris, London, Geneva or New York.
In just over two weeks, the IAA will take place in Munich for the first time, a good time to look back at the trade fairs in Berlin and Frankfurt.
